Veterinary students’ choices of clinical extramural placements are associated with their final‐year examination performance

open access: yesVeterinary Record, EarlyView.
Abstract Background UK veterinary students must complete 20 weeks of clinical extramural studies (EMS) in placements of their choice. We investigated the associations between EMS choices and performance in the final‐year ‘livestock and One Health’, ‘equine’ and ‘small animal’ written examinations.

Mobile consumers influence the shoreward edge of intertidal seagrass ecosystems

open access: yesJournal of Animal Ecology, EarlyView.
Ecological paradigms suggest that the environmentally stressful edge of a habitat is determined by physical factors. The work finds that, counter to these paradigms, an environmentally stressful edge can also be impacted by biotic interactions and are more complex than suggested.
